* {
    --rl-background-color: #FFFFFF;
    border: 0px;
}

html {
    font-family: "Questrial", ui-sans-serif, system-ui, -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, "Helvetica Neue", Arial, "Noto Sans", sans-serif, "Apple Color Emoji", "Segoe UI Emoji", "Segoe UI Symbol", "Noto Color Emoji";
    font-feature-settings: normal;
    font-variation-settings: normal;
    -webkit-text-size-adjust: 100%;
}

body {
    background-color: var(--rl-background-color)
}

.dot-pulse,
.dot-pulse::before, .dot-pulse::after {
    background-color: rgb(75 85 99);
    color: rgb(75 85 99);
}

.rl-header {
    height: 70px;
}

.logo-image {
    width: 26px;
    margin-top: 1px;
}

.right-header .edit-button {
    padding: 0.6rem;
}

.right-header .edit-button svg {
    width: 16px;
    height: 16px;
}

.rl-body {
    margin-top: 70px;
}

.rl-body > #chat {
    max-width: 790px;
    font-family: "Helvetica", Sans-serif;
}

.rl-body > #introduce {
    height: calc(100vh - 270px);
}

body:not(.in-search) #footer-search {
	position:static;
}

.menu-dropdown .icon-opened {
    display: none;
}

.menu-dropdown:hover > .icon-opened, .menu-dropdown:hover > .list-menu {
    display: inline-block;
}

.menu-dropdown .icon-closed {
    display: inline-block;
}

.menu-dropdown:hover > .icon-closed {
    display: none;
}

.menu-dropdown .list-menu {
    top: 40px;
    display: none;
    /*display: block;*/
}

.icon-active-model, .active .icon-inactive-model {
    display: none;
}

.icon-inactive-model, .active .icon-active-model {
    display: block;
}

.menu-dropdown .menu-box {
    width: 100%;
    box-shadow: 0px 0px 15px 0px rgba(0, 0, 0, 0.2);
}

.menu-icon {
    fill: #ffffff;
}

.menu-icon.e-far-circle {
    width: 17px;
}

.menu-icon.e-fas-check {
    width: 10px;
}

.intro-brand-img img {
    width: 54px;
}

.btn-submit-example {
    padding: 8px;
    display: none;
}

.example-item:hover .btn-submit-example {
    display: block;
}

.e-fas-arrow-up {
    width: 10px;
}

.prompt-input {
    max-height: 52px;
}

.prompt-input .e-fas-arrow-up {
    width: 14px;
}

#send {
    width: 52px;
}

.avatar-icon {
    width: 24px;
    height: 24px;
    padding: 7px;
}

.rl-icon {
    width: 24px;
    height: 24px;
}

.reactive-icon {
    width: 15px;
    height: 15px;
}

.fa-icon {
    width: 50px;
    height: 50px;
}

.chat-item:last-child {
    padding-block-end: 119px;
}

.source-content {
    font-family: "Helvetica", Sans-serif;
    font-size: 12px;
}

.toggle-source-btn .fas.fa-minus, .toggle-source-btn.active .fas.fa-plus {
    display: none;
}

.toggle-source-btn .fas.fa-plus, .toggle-source-btn.active .fas.fa-minus {
    display: inline-block;
}

.source-item {
    border-bottom: 1px solid #582695;
}

@media screen and (min-width: 480px) {
    .menu-dropdown .menu-box {
        width: 450px;
        float: right;
    }
}
